Job Description- The Rad Tech reflects the mission, vision, and values of NM, adheres to the organization’s Code of Ethics and Corporate Compliance Program, and complies with all relevant policies, procedures, guidelines and all other regulatory and accreditation standards.
- This position is capable of taking any or all types of radiographs with several different types of equipment. He/she functions as the first line interface with patients/customers in the successful accomplishment of their imaging needs.
- Utilize markers consistently.
- Instruct and prepare patients for radiographic and/or fluoroscopic examinations.
- Demonstrate overall knowledge of exams.
- Produce high‑quality films consistently.
- Understand and properly use CR, the PRID, ADC Multiloader, and QS workstation.
- Write complete patient histories for the radiologists.
- Utilize PACS with few errors.
- Demonstrate overall efficiency of work and time; use slow time constructively, e.g., stocking rooms, emptying linen, putting away supplies, helping transport, etc.
- Assess patient pain interfering with imaging procedure and make appropriate physician contact for intervention.
- Demonstrate knowledge of how to access Pyxis, what medications are available for what procedures, and understand that the doctor verifies the correct medication upon receipt.
- Practice medical and surgical aseptic procedures (good handwashing).
- Multitask in several areas.
- Acknowledge exams on a timely basis and completely.
- Graduation from an approved school of Radiology Technology, either college affiliated or hospital trained.
- American Registry of Registered Technologist (ARRT) within 3 months of graduation; new graduates need Certificate of Completion from the college.
- Certified by the State of Illinois to practice and administer radiation (IEMA). New graduates required to apply for temporary license which, when received, is valid in the state for two years.
- CPR – Basic Life Support.
- Physical demands: lift/carry up to 50 pounds and a push/pull force up to 50 pounds.
- Bachelor of Science degree.
- Previous Rad Tech experience.
